Loan Payments You may make payments in amounts from $25.00 to $10,000.00. Your payment will be made electronically through the Automated Clearing House, an electronic banking network operating in the United States. Rules and regulations governing the ACH network are established by the National Automated Clearing House Association and the Federal Reserve and will apply to your payments. If you authorize a recurring payment as an Enrolled User, those payments will continue until the specified end date, unless you cancel the recurring payment. You may schedule a future-dated payment using the Service, specifying a date on which we are to process the payment, with the limitation that this date cannot be more than 10 calendar days in the future. If the specified date is not a business day, the payment will be the next business day. Enrolled Users may make recurring payments to their loan accounts, specifying the payment amount, frequency, start date and end date. (ii) Funding Account. When you instruct us to make a payment through the Service, you must designate a checking account from which that payment is to be made. This is called the “Funding Account”. By using the Service, you agree that we have the right to obtain information regarding your Funding Account from your financial institution, as necessary, to allow us to provide the Service (for example, to resolve a payment posting problem). By designating the Funding Account, you are representing to us that you either own the Funding Account or are an authorized signer on the Funding Account for purposes of making payments through this Service. (iii) Payments. You must provide sufficient information about each payment such as but not limited to, loan account number, amount and Funding Account (the “Payment Instruction”) to authorize us to make the requested loan payment. When the Service receives a Payment Instruction, you authorize us to debit your Funding Account in the amount of the loan payment and any associated fees. Funds will generally be withdrawn from the Funding Account on the second business day following the Transaction Date, depending upon the agreements with the financial institution at which the Funding Account is located. The date funds are withdrawn from your Funding Account is referred to as the “Funding Date.” You also authorize us to credit your Funding Account if necessary as a result of overpayments or other credits that may be due to you in connection with this Service. If sufficient funds are not available in your Funding Account on the Funding Date, the loan payment will be cancelled and you will be responsible for any late payment related charges or fees as described in your loan documents with Eastern Bank. You will also be solely responsible for any overdraft or related fees charged by the financial institution where the Funding Account is located. (iv) Canceling Payments. You may use the Service to cancel or edit a future-dated payment prior to 6:00 p.m. Eastern Time on the business day preceding the Transaction Date. If you need to cancel or edit a future-dated payment on the Transaction Date, you may also call 1-800-EASTERN (1-800-327-8376) during the hours of 8: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m. Eastern Time Monday through Friday. In Case of Errors or Questions Eastern Bank We must hear from you no later than sixty (60) calendar days after we sent the FIRST statement on which the problem appeared. We will need:
If the report is made orally, we will require that you send the complaint or question in writing within ten (10) business days following the date you notified us. We will tell you the results of our investigation within ten (10) calendar days of the date you notified us and will correct any error promptly. If we need more time, however, we may take up to forty-five (45) calendar days to investigate your complaint or question following the date you notified us. If we decide to take this additional time, we will provisionally credit your Funding Account within ten (10) calendar days following the date you notified us for the amount you think is in error, so that you will have the use of your money during the time it takes us to complete our investigation. (Note: If we do not receive your written notice of the problem within ten (10) business days of your initial contact with the Bank, we may not provisionally credit your Funding Account.) We will tell you the results within three (3) business days after completing our investigation. If we determine that there was no error, we will send you a written explanation. You may, at no cost, examine and inspect all documents that we used in our investigation. You may also, for a reasonable fee to cover our photocopying costs, ask for copies of the documents that we used in our investigation. I.
